Not a Day
Dear K, Not a day passes that I don't feel You surrounding my world. A gentle breeze wisps across my face And I'm reminded of your soft hands. Those palms i used to rest my head in. I could sleep forever in your hands. I'm convinced I did fall asleep long ago, Since the first time I laid in your arms I've been dreaming and I pray nothing Will ever wake me from this slumber. The foods I eat take my lips on a journey, Remembering the sweet taste of your Grapefruit lip balm. How fitting it was, The various tropical fruits you tasted like, Because your kiss was always paradise to me. Not a single day passes, my love. -Michael
